You must dry the wood as much as possible using paper towels, a hair dryer, and … birdhouse sewing fatgumWebToo much sun can be detrimental to a paint finish, just as too much rain can be. After it rains, we typically wait a couple of days to make sure that the siding is perfectly dry. After all, even if it feels dry to the touch, that doesn’t mean that moisture isn’t still captured within. bird houses clearance wholesaleWebHowever, sanding acrylic paint on wood can be a tricky process. If you want to sand acrylic paint on wood, do it carefully to avoid damaging the surface or removing too much paint. Firstly, before sanding acrylic paint on wood, you must wait until it has completely dried. Sanding wet or tacky paint will only lead to smearing and uneven finishes. damaged import carsWebMay 4, 2024 · Trying to put “wet” lumber through a planer, a jointer, a sander or even cutting it with a saw can cause both damages to the tools and danger to you.
